ISLAMABAD: The Federal Finance Ministry approved a price hike on all petroleum products excluding the price of high speed diesel, which will be effective from midnight, DawnNews reported on Sunday.

The price of petrol was expected to increase by Rs 3.04 per litre, the price of light speed diesel would be increased by Rs 0.48 per litre and the price of kerosene oil was expected to rise by Rs 0.72 per litre.

The price of high speed diesel was cut by Rs 2.7 per litre.

The per kilo price of Compressed Natural Gas (CNG) would be increased by Rs 2.78 in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, Potohar and Balochistan (Zone-I) whereas the prices for Punjab and Sindh (Zone-II) would rise by Rs 2.54.

A notification in this regards would be issued tonight and all the price changes would be effective from midnight Sunday.
